<nav>
是一个用于定义网页导航链接部分的HTML5元素。
以下是 <nav>
标签的一些详细说明:
- 标签定义:
<nav>
标签用于包裹页面上主要的导航链接,这些链接可能导向站点的其他页面或者当前页面的其他部分。这个元素的目的是为浏览器、搜索引擎以及辅助技术如屏幕阅读器提供一个明确的区域识别,以更好地理解页面结构。 - 使用场景:不是所有的 HTML 文档都需要
<nav>
元素。它适用于那些有明确导航结构,如菜单、目录、索引等的页面。对于较简单的单页应用或宣传页面,可能就不需要此标签。 - 设备适配:在不同设备上(如手机和PC),开发者可以决定是否显示
<nav>
包含的导航链接,从而适应不同屏幕尺寸和用户需求。 - 全局属性支持:
<nav>
标签支持所有全局属性,这意味着你可以添加像id
、class
这样的属性来增强样式和功能。 - 事件属性支持:除了全局属性外,
<nav>
还支持所有 HTML 事件属性,允许你添加交互性,比如点击或鼠标悬停事件。
通过使用 <nav>
标签,网站开发者能够提供更清晰的结构和更好的可访问性。
<nav>
是一个HTML5元素,用于定义网页中的导航链接部分。
这个元素的主要作用是帮助浏览器和搜索引擎识别页面上哪些部分包含了导航链接,从而改善网站的可用性和可访问性。它通常包含一组链接,这些链接可以指向其他页面或者当前页面的其他部分。使用<nav>
元素可以让开发者更明确地标记出网站的导航结构,这对于屏幕阅读器等辅助技术来说尤其重要,因为它们可以帮助用户更快地找到他们想要的信息。
以下是<nav>
元素的一些关键特点:
- 适应性:
<nav>
元素可以帮助开发者在不同设备上(如手机或PC)定制导航链接的显示方式,以适应不同屏幕尺寸的需求。 - 语义化:作为HTML5的新标签,
<nav>
提供了更好的语义化标记,有助于搜索引擎优化(SEO)和提高网站的可维护性。 - 选择性:并不是所有的链接都需要放在
<nav>
元素内。应该只包含那些主要的、基本的、重要的导航链接组。
总的来说,<nav>
元素是现代网页设计中一个重要的工具,它不仅提高了网页的结构清晰度,还有助于提升用户体验。在实际应用中,应当合理利用<nav>
元素,以确保其发挥最大的效用。